What You’ll Need

Apple Cider Cookies 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ious Apple Cider Cookies:

  • All-Purpose Flour: About 2 cups will give you the perfect base for these cookies—soft yet sturdy enough to hold all those delightful flavors.
  • Baking Soda: Just a teaspoon is needed to help your cookies rise and stay fluffy.
  • Cinnamon: A generous tablespoon adds that warm spice flavor we all know and love during fall.
  • Brown Sugar: Using one cup of packed brown sugar lends moisture and a deep caramel flavor to our cookies.
  • Granulated Sugar: About half a cup for rolling those delightful cookies before baking—because who doesn’t love that sugary crunch?
  • Unsalted Butter: One stick (or half a cup) softened makes these cookies rich and decadent; don’t skimp on this!
  • Egg: One large egg acts as the binder and helps the cookie keep its shape while baking.
  • Apple Cider: The star ingredient! About half a cup of apple cider adds moisture and that yummy apple flavor.

Cooking Instructions

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ious Apple Cider Cookies:

Step 1: Preheat Your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). While it warms up, line two baking sheets with parchment paper because nobody wants sticky cookies stuck to their pans.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t. Make sure they’re combined well; we want an even spread of flavors throughout our heavenly cookies!

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ugars

In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until light and fluffy—this usually takes about three minutes but feels like an eternity if you’re hungry!

Step 4: Add Egg and Apple Cider

Beat in the egg followed by the apple cider until everything’s well combined. It should smell divine right about now; if not, check if you have your nose over the mixing bowl!

Step 5: Combine Wet and Dry Mixtures

Gradually add the dry mixture to the wet ingredients until fully incorporated. Your dough should be thick yet slightly sticky—just how we like it.

Step 6: Bake Those Cookies!

Using a tablespoon or cookie scoop, drop rounded balls of dough onto prepared baking sheets about two inches apart. Roll them in granulated sugar for that extra sweetness before popping them into the oven. Bake for about 10-12 minutes until they are lightly golden around the edges but still soft in the middle.

Flavor Your Way

Feel free to swap out some of the all-purpose flour for whole wheat flour for a healthier twist. You can also experiment with spices like nutmeg or cardamom for a unique flavor profile. Adding chopped walnuts or dried cranberries enhances texture and provides a delightful surprise in every bite.

Storing & Reheating

Store your Apple Cider C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to five days. For longer storage, freeze them in a single layer before transferring to a freezer bag. When reheating, pop them in the microwave for a few seconds for that fresh-baked warmth.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1 tbsp cinnamon
  • 1 cup packed brown sugar
  • ½ cup granulated sugar (for rolling)
  • ½ cup unsalted butter (softened)
  • 1 large egg
  • ½ cup apple cider

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.
  3. Cream softened but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until light and fluffy.
  4. Beat in the egg followed by apple cider until well combined.
  5. Gradually mix dry ingredients into the wet mixture until fully incorporated.
  6.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to baking sheets, roll in granulated sugar, spacing them about two inches apart.
  7. Bake for 10-12 minutes until edges are lightly golden but centers remain soft.
